Remember your pets this 4th of July
Contributed by: Arvada Police on 6/27/2008

Arvada's Animal Management Unit says July 5 is the busiest day of the year at local animal shelters because so many pets are found miles from home after jumping through open windows or over fences. The reason: fireworks are incredibly loud to pets' ears and they often run away from home out of fear and get disoriented.

"This is an exciting time of year, but for pets, this holiday can be terrifying. Don't get caught spending the 5th of July trying to find your pets," said Becky Robison, supervisor of the Arvada Police Department's Animal Management Unit.

On the Fourth, leave your dog inside your house where it can be sheltered and feel safer. If you know your dog is afraid of fireworks, have someone stay home with it. Contact your veterinarian to see if tranquilizers are right for your pet.

Remember, the Fourth of July is fun, but take steps to ensure you and Fido can go for a walk on the fifth.
